Ottenere le informazioni su un cliente con le API di WHMCS

Ottenere le informazioni su un cliente con le API di WHMCS

Con le API di WHMCS possiamo ottenere le informazioni su un cliente.

Possiamo implementare la seguente soluzione.


function get_client_info($client_id) {
    $client = [];

    if(!ctype_digit($client_id) || !filter_var($client_id, FILTER_VALIDATE_INT)) {
        return $client;
    }
    $command = 'GetClientsDetails';
    $data = [
        'clientid' => $client_id,
        'stats' => false
    ];
    $results = localAPI($command, $data);
    if($results['result'] !== 'success') {
        return $client;
    }
    $client = $results['client'];
    return $client;
}

Torna su